New ways that living matter can be reproduced on a cellular scale https://innovationtoronto.com/2023/07/new-ways-that-living-matter-can-be-reproduced-on-a-cellular-scale/
New ways that living matter can be reproduced on a cellular scale https://innovationtoronto.com/2023/07/new-ways-that-living-matter-can-be-reproduced-on-a-cellular-scale/